温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

初学者如何快速上手Python MVC框架

发布时间:2024-09-07 18:05:42 来源:亿速云 阅读:84 作者:小樊 栏目:编程语言

对于初学者来说,掌握Python MVC框架可以帮助你更有效地进行Web应用开发。以下是一些步骤和资源,可以帮助你快速上手Python MVC框架:

学习Python基础

在开始学习Python MVC框架之前,确保你已经掌握了Python的基本语法和编程概念。这包括变量、数据类型、控制流语句、函数等。

了解MVC框架的基本概念

  • 模型(Model):负责处理数据和业务逻辑。
  • 视图(View):负责显示数据,即用户界面。
  • 控制器(Controller):负责接收用户输入,调用模型处理数据,并更新视图。

选择一个适合的框架

  • Django:一个全功能的Web框架,内置ORM、模板引擎等,适合快速开发大型Web应用。
  • Flask:一个轻量级的Web框架,提供了基本的Web开发功能,适合小型项目和API开发。
  • Pyramid:一个灵活的Web框架,提供了可插拔的组件,适合需要自由选择组件的项目。

学习框架的基本用法

  • Django:创建项目、应用、模型、视图和模板,配置URL,以及使用Django的管理界面。
  • Flask:安装Flask,创建应用,定义路由和视图函数,使用Jinja2模板引擎,以及处理表单和数据库。

实践项目

通过实践项目来巩固学习成果。可以从简单的CRUD(创建、读取、更新、删除)应用开始,逐步增加功能。

深入学习

  • Django:深入了解Django的ORM、模板系统、表单处理、用户认证等高级特性。
  • Flask:学习如何使用Flask的扩展,如Flask-SQLAlchemy、Flask-Mail等,来增强应用的功能。

利用在线资源

  • 官方文档:阅读框架的官方文档是学习的好方法,它提供了最详细和最新的信息。
  • 教程和视频:利用网上的教程和视频资源,这些资源可以帮助你更直观地理解概念。
  • 社区和论坛:加入相关的社区和论坛,与其他开发者交流经验和解决问题。

通过以上步骤,初学者可以逐步掌握Python MVC框架,并应用于实际的Web开发项目中。记住,实践是学习的关键,不断动手做项目可以帮助你更好地理解和掌握所学知识。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I